But with recent implosion within the party, it seems that the election results were just the beginning of series of troubles for the Mamata Banerjee-led party.This week, 58 party MLAs rebelled openly, staking claim to become the principal Opposition party in Bengal, vertically splitting the party. And when the leadership of the crisis-hit party called a meeting at chairperson Mamata's residence on Friday, only eight of the non-rebelling MLAs were present. We are the real TMC now in the assembly,” said Ritabrata.“Our claim has been accepted by the speaker,” he told reporters after meeting the speaker.TMC rebellion to reach courtThe TMC is planning legal action over the West Bengal assembly speaker's decision to appoint TMC rebel Ritabrata as the Leader of the Opposition, with the party MP Kalyan Banerjee terming the decision “illegal”.“We have decided that the LoP appointed by the Speaker is illegal. We are approaching the Court against this on Monday. We will file a petition before the High Court,” Banerjee said. He further accused the BJP of “killing” TMC workers and lodging false cases against them.’“We will fight on the streets, we will fight in Court,” Kalyan said after party leader and former CM Mamata Banerjee held a meeting at her residence in Kalighat area of Kolkata on Friday.
